About the Role 

In this role you will be providing administrative support to the Older Rehabilitation Adult (ORA) team that go out into the community as well as Geriatricians. Responsibilities include the scheduling of their outpatient appointments, booking calendar appointments for home visits and management of Community Health/ORA Cars. 

You will also be the first point of contact for patients, external medical representatives or internal staff needing to make appointments or contact the clinical staff. Other general duties include word processing duties, minute taking and general assistance to the Clinicians. 

This role works 21 hours per week so offers excellent work-life balance. You will be rostered to work 4 hours per day, 4 days a week, with 5 hours being worked on a Thursday.

About the Team/Service/Location 

The Patient Administration Service works across the District to support a patients journey from referral through to discharge. PAS is comprised of several difference services:

  • Outpatient Booking Centre, Call Centre and Atrium
  • Clinical Typing & Team Support
  • Ward Administration & Elective booking
  • Outpatient Reception and Administration Support
  • Emergency Department and Radiology

Each area has a dedicated Team Leader to provide one point of contact across the group. Our collective goal is to provide efficient and effective administration support that enables clinical staff to focus on providing quality care to patients. This role is part of the Outpatient Reception and Administrative Support service and is situated within the Community Health team at Kenepuru Hospital. You will be working closely with both clinical and non-clinical staff to ensure the service needs are met.
